Job summary

Indorama Ventures is seeking an Environmental Compliance Specialist for the Port Neches Operations. You will ensure compliance with air regulatory programs, maintain environmental databases, and support emissions reporting and regulatory interpretations.

You will review emissions data, prepare regulatory reports, renew and amend permits, and collaborate with teams to improve safety, reliability, and environmental performance. Regular presence in the plant is required.

Qualifications

  • 4-year Bachelor Degree in Environmental Science or Related Field.
  • 1-10 yrs Related Experience.
  • Experience with NSPS and NESHAP regulations, Environmental Permitting (e.g., NSR, Title V, TPDES, etc.), Title V reporting, air quality regulations, emission event reporting, corporate auditing, and database management.
  • Air permitting and/or compliance experience a plus.
  • Petrochemical Industry experience a plus.
  • Strong Excel, Word, and database skills.
  • Must have a level of proficiency with Internet, Email, and Microsoft programs.
  • Experience with TCEQ Regulatory Databases preferred.
